Issue detection and pumping unit control optimization across various asset types


Location: Texas & Oklahoma
Asset type: 2000s and 2010s vintage horizontal & vertical wells
Product focus: Connected smart controller, platform features including visualization and automated diagnosis


Independent operators in Texas and Oklahoma running vertical and horizontal rod pump wells needed automation that could handle difficult downhole conditions — including gas slugging that traditional pump-off controllers struggle to manage.

Amplified's IoT well controller was deployed across both states with no existing SCADA or telecom required. The platform delivers oilfield automation and field automation through real-time monitoring, well optimization, and active rod lift control — automatically detecting and alerting operators to downhole and surface issues — tubing leaks, rod parts, valve conditions, and more — in near real-time.

Before Amplified Industries Our customers are a group of independent oil & gas operators based in Texas and Oklahoma with a mix of conventional vertical and unconventional horizontal wells, mostly drilled in either the mid-2000s or mid-to-late 2010s. With these assets continuing to move down the decline curve and becoming more difficult to efficiently produce, our customers were looking for a modern system that was both cost effective and easy to adopt at scale, but also, in the case of the horizontal wells, able to cope with the difficult slugging conditions that more expensive traditional controllers struggle to manage.
